首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何从ts中的对象中获取值?

在 TypeScript 中,可以通过以下几种方式从对象中获取值:

  1. 使用点符号(.)访问对象属性:
代码语言:txt
复制
const obj = { name: 'John', age: 25 };
const name = obj.name; // 获取 name 属性的值
const age = obj.age; // 获取 age 属性的值
  1. 使用方括号([])和属性名访问对象属性:
代码语言:txt
复制
const obj = { name: 'John', age: 25 };
const name = obj['name']; // 获取 name 属性的值
const age = obj['age']; // 获取 age 属性的值
  1. 使用可选链操作符(?.)访问嵌套对象属性(TypeScript 3.7+):
代码语言:txt
复制
const obj = { person: { name: 'John', age: 25 } };
const name = obj.person?.name; // 获取嵌套对象的 name 属性的值
const age = obj.person?.age; // 获取嵌套对象的 age 属性的值
  1. 使用解构赋值从对象中提取属性值:
代码语言:txt
复制
const obj = { name: 'John', age: 25 };
const { name, age } = obj; // 从对象中提取 name 和 age 属性的值

以上是从 TypeScript 对象中获取值的常见方法。根据具体的应用场景和需求,选择适合的方式来获取对象中的值。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的结果

领券